Dachau Concentration Camp Memorial Site Tour from Munich by Train

1.Dachau Concentration Camp Memorial Site Tour from Munich by Train

★★★★★★★★★★4.5 · 5,637 reviews · 5 hours (approx.) · from $64Our pick

Travel from Munich to Dachau by local train and bus, then spend three hours at the memorial with a guide such as Nick, Jake, Nicola, or Aileen. Expect a serious, carefully explained visit covering the camp gate, barracks, cells, memorials, and the site’s role in Nazi Germany.

Guided Dachau Concentration Camp Memorial Site Tour with Train from Munich

3.Guided Dachau Concentration Camp Memorial Site Tour with Train from Munich

★★★★★★★★★★5.0 · 920 reviews · 5 hours (approx.) · from $90Top rated

Travel from Munich’s Marienplatz to Dachau with memorial guide Alun Evans, using public transport and spending about three hours at the site. Expect a careful, factual visit covering the barracks, crematorium, gas chamber, bunker, museum, and the history of the Nazi regime.

Nuremberg Guided Day Trip from Munich by Train

5.Nuremberg Guided Day Trip from Munich by Train

★★★★★★★★★★4.5 · 546 reviews · 8 hours 30 minutes (approx.) · from $95

Travel from Munich to Nuremberg by regional train with an English-speaking guide. Walk through the medieval Old Town, visit the Imperial Castle, and see the former Nazi Rally Grounds. The tour suits history-minded visitors who prefer an organized day, but free time can be limited.
